School table tennis final
The Shirley Boys’ High School team of Tim Hanrahan, Karl Entwistle and Darrin Entwistle was beaten. 7-4 by Wellington College in the final of the national inter-secondary schools table tennis competition.
The top-ranked New Zealand under-16 player. Robert Kerr..paved the way for. the Wellington side's victory by winning all his three singles. Hanrahan, with two singles wins, was Shirley’s most successful player.
